Try this...
Put 1 round in mag.
Fire the gun with your left hand, elbow and wrist locked, body turned sideways. Turn and repeat with right hand.
Now turn gun sideways (gangsta style) and repeat.
If it locked back it's your grip not the gun. 99% of the time it's the shooter's grip.
Especially if it locks back when you rack it by hand - check that - shoot it empty and then when it doesn't lock back, without moving your right hand, rack the slide back all the way with your left. If it locks back, your follower is not bypassing your slide stop, so it is either your grip or the spring is too strong (but springs tend to get weaker with use not stronger...)
